Документация Hadoop для Eclipse

Недавно я установил Hadoop и могу запускать простые программы.

Однако мне хотелось бы просмотреть документацию для классов Hadoop в браузере Javadoc в Eclipse.

Пожалуйста, дайте мне знать, как включить это (я немного начинаю с Eclipse IDE).

Спасибо.

Ответ 1

Несколько предложений:

  • Если вы используете maven для управления зависимостями, вы должны иметь возможность расширять список зависимостей Maven в своем проекте Eclipse, щелкните правой кнопкой мыши на hasoop-core-xxxjar и выберите Maven → Загрузить Javadocs

  • В противном случае вам нужно будет отправить Javadocs из папки $HADOOP_HOME/docs/api и связать с вашим файлом hadoop-core-x.x.x.jar в Eclipse. В Eclipse щелкните правой кнопкой мыши ваш проект Java и выберите "Путь сборки" → "Настроить путь сборки". Теперь перейдите на вкладку "Библиотеки" и найдите запись для файла hasoop-core-x.x.x.jar. Разверните запись, чтобы показать параметры для местоположений источника, Javadoc и нажмите запись местоположения Javadoc. Теперь нажмите кнопку "Изменить" справа и введите местоположение в качестве пути $HADOOP_HOME/docs/api в текстовое поле Javadoc URL (my file:/opt/hadoop/hadoop-1.0.2/docs/api/)

В любом случае теперь вы сможете навести курсор на классы Hadoop в Eclipse, и появится всплывающее окно Javadoc. Вы также можете показать окно Javadoc, которое будет заполнено для класса, который вы просматриваете в данный момент, или просто открыть окно внутреннего браузера и указать его в файле $HADOOP_HOME/docs/api/index.html

Ответ 2

Другим простым решением для тех, кто хочет обновиться, является редактирование пути Javadocs, как сказал Крис:

"В Eclipse щелкните правой кнопкой мыши ваш проект Java и выберите" Путь сборки "- > " Настроить путь сборки ". Теперь перейдите на вкладку" Библиотеки "и найдите запись для hasoop-core-xxxjar. Разверните запись, чтобы показать параметры для Source, Javadoc и т.д. местоположения и щелкните запись местоположения Javadoc. Теперь нажмите кнопку" Изменить "справа и введите местоположение в качестве пути"

но вместо того, чтобы связывать его непосредственно с api, который вы сохранили на жестком диске, соедините его с http://hadoop.apache.org/docs/stable/api/